Full Job Description
- Supervising and maintaining discipline of pupils before, during and after meals, including active supervision in the playground or in the hall or classroom during wet weather.
- The duties shall include escorting the children to the dining room and helping generally during the serving of the meal.
- In the case of infants, the duties shall include carrying of plated meals to the tables (unless other arrangements have been made by the Head Teacher), cutting up meat etc. training them in the use of knives and forks.
- Supervisors must ensure that children are not left unsupervised at any time.
- In Secondary Schools the supervision includes controlling the lunch queue both inside and outside the canteen.
